Greenwich Village

(grenic̸h)

section of New York City, on the lower west side of Manhattan: noted as a center for artists, writers, etc.: formerly a village

A mainly residential section of lower Manhattan in New York City. Settled during colonial times, the area began to attract notice as an artists' and writers' community after 1910.
